Without knowing the true severity of her autism her openness to romance is an unknown. If you removed her autism from consideration, it's understandable she wouldn't be interested in close relationships. Her mother had dysfunctional relationships with men. She was in prior foster homes where her foster parents kept "giving her back" to the system. It's no wonder she was gun-shy about getting too attached to anyone, let alone having a boyfriend.

She was finally in a good home and had positive role models in a committed relationship when her life went sideways and she was almost kicked out of another home. Thankfully, at the end of the book it looked like life was headed in a positive direction.
